Performs other necessary duties as required by JHC and as directed by the Dentist to meet the goal of providing oral health care services. Clinical Duties: 1. Performs preventive dental care for patients as prescribed by the Dentist. This includes dental scaling, prophylaxis, fluoride treatment, taking appropriate diagnostic x-rays, and applying dental sealants. 2. Performs preliminary examination of patient's dentition and gingiva, including charting existing restorations, any dental pathology, and measuring and recording periodontal pocket depths. 3. Performs suture removal. 4. Cleans instruments, performs tray set up and updates patient's medical information in the EMR. 5.
